Azoospermia simply means that no sperm are detected in a semen sample. The condition is classified into two main types: obstructive azoospermia (OA), where sperm are produced but blocked from reaching the ejaculate, and non-obstructive azoospermia (NOA), where sperm production itself is impaired.

Step-by-Step Azoospermia Treatment Process with HomeIVF

Understanding the treatment journey helps reduce anxiety and empowers couples to make informed decisions. Here is how the process typically unfolds when you begin your azoospermia treatment through HomeIVF in Bellandur.

Step 1 — Initial Consultation: A senior fertility specialist from the HomeIVF Medical Board conducts a detailed video or in-home consultation. Medical history, lifestyle factors, and any prior reports are reviewed carefully.

Step 2 — Diagnostic Workup: Semen analysis, hormonal panels (FSH, LH, testosterone, prolactin), scrotal ultrasound, and genetic testing (karyotype, Y-chromosome microdeletion) are co-ordinated with trusted diagnostic partners near Bellandur. Home sample collection is available for semen analysis.

Step 3 — Classification and Planning: Based on diagnostics, the HomeIVF Medical Board classifies the azoospermia type and recommends the appropriate treatment — hormonal therapy, TESA, Micro-TESE, or a combination approach.

Step 4 — Sperm Retrieval: The surgical procedure (TESA or Micro-TESE) is performed at a partner clinic in Bangalore under anaesthesia. Retrieved sperm are cryopreserved immediately for use in IVF or ICSI.

Step 5 — IVF or ICSI Cycle: The female partner undergoes ovarian stimulation, egg retrieval, and fertilisation using retrieved sperm via ICSI. Embryo development is monitored closely.

Step 6 — Embryo Transfer and Support: The healthiest embryo is transferred into the uterus. Luteal support medications are prescribed and follow-up is managed by the HomeIVF team from the comfort of your Bellandur home.

Medical Decision Drivers: TESA, Micro-TESE, and IVF Explained

Choosing the right surgical approach is one of the most critical decisions in azoospermia treatment, and it depends entirely on the underlying diagnosis confirmed through investigations.

TESA (Testicular Sperm Aspiration) is a minimally invasive procedure where a fine needle is used to aspirate sperm directly from the testicular tissue. It is typically recommended for obstructive azoospermia and carries a high sperm retrieval success rate — often between 60 and 90 percent in suitable candidates. Recovery is quick, usually within 24 to 48 hours, making it well-suited for working professionals in Bellandur.

Micro-TESE (Microsurgical Testicular Sperm Extraction) is a more advanced technique involving microsurgery to identify and extract sperm-producing tubules from the testes. It is the preferred approach for non-obstructive azoospermia where sperm production is patchy or severely impaired. The HomeIVF Medical Board ensures this procedure is recommended only when diagnostics clearly support it, avoiding unnecessary intervention.

ICsi (Intracytoplasmic Sperm Injection) is invariably used alongside retrieved sperm during IVF, since sperm numbers are typically low. A single viable sperm is injected directly into a mature egg, maximising fertilisation potential. What is the difference between TESA and Micro-TESE for azoospermia treatment in Bangalore?+

TESA (Testicular Sperm Aspiration) uses a fine needle to retrieve sperm and is typically recommended for obstructive azoospermia with success rates of 60-90%. Micro-TESE is a microsurgical technique used for non-obstructive azoospermia, with retrieval rates of 40-60%. Can azoospermia be treated if I have non-obstructive azoospermia?+

Non-obstructive azoospermia is more challenging but not untreatable. In many cases, Micro-TESE can successfully retrieve viable sperm even when sperm production is significantly impaired. Hormonal therapy may also improve sperm production in select cases caused by hormonal deficiencies. What is the success rate of IVF using surgically retrieved sperm in Bangalore?+

IVF success rates in India using surgically retrieved sperm via ICSI typically range from 40-55% per cycle, depending on the woman's age, egg quality, embryo quality, and the underlying cause of azoospermia. Younger women with good ovarian reserve tend to have higher success rates.
